Annotation |
The purpose of the study was to clarify the diagnostic significance of neutrophil gelatinase-associated lipocalin and cystatin C in the blood of patients with arterial h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us and their correlation with intrarenal hemodynamic parameters. It was installed that in comparison with persons without diabetes in patients with arterial h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us at the stage of preclinical kidney damage found a more significant increase in neutrophil gelatinase-associated lipocalin and cystatin C in the blood. This allows us to consider these indicators as diagnostic manifestations of early detection of diabetic nephropathy. It was determined that a significant decrease in the final diastolic arterial blood flow velocities and a significant increase in the resistance index are diagnostic markers of morpho-functional changes in the kidneys during duplex scanning of the renal arteries in patients with arterial h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us. |
